Commodity markets are maintaining their bullish trajectory, fueled by robust demand and persistent supply chain challenges. This trend is impacting various sectors, from energy to agriculture, and prompting investors to reassess their portfolios.
Key Factors Driving the Bull Market
- Increased Global Demand: Emerging economies and recovering developed nations are driving demand for raw materials.
- Supply Chain Disruptions: Geopolitical tensions and logistical bottlenecks are limiting supply.
- Inflationary Pressures: Commodities are often seen as a hedge against inflation, further boosting demand.
- Weather Events: Adverse weather conditions are impacting agricultural production, leading to higher prices.
Impact on Different Sectors
The bullish commodity market is having a significant impact on various sectors:
- Energy: Rising oil and gas prices are affecting transportation and manufacturing costs.
- Agriculture: Higher grain and livestock prices are impacting food prices for consumers.
- Metals: Increased demand for metals is driving up prices for construction and manufacturing.
